At 10:00 AM, you will meet at the designated office in Riobamba, where your adventure begins. From there, you'll transfer to the Chimborazo Basecamp Lodge, a cozy and well-equipped retreat situated at an elevation of 3,900 meters. Upon arrival, you’ll be welcomed with a warm atmosphere and breathtaking views of Chimborazo, the highest peak in Ecuador. Your acclimatization journey starts here, with all meals provided, beginning with a hearty lunch that features local flavors and nutritious options to energize you for the day. Take the afternoon to adjust to the altitude, explore the surrounding trails, and enjoy the serene beauty of the high Andes. This day is designed to help your body prepare for higher elevations while immersing you in the majestic environment of Chimborazo.
After breakfast at Chimborazo Basecamp, we gather and begin our drive toward the Chimborazo Reserve. This scenic drive takes us closer to the base of the mountain, where the real adventure begins. From the reserve, we start our trek up toward the glacier at 5,300 meters (17,388 feet). The hike is designed to help you acclimatize while providing an introduction to glacier travel.

This training session will last around six hours, giving you plenty of time to practice and become comfortable with the equipment and techniques necessary for a safe and successful summit attempt.
After completing the glacier training, we return to Chimborazo Basecamp for a well-deserved late lunch. The meal will provide you with the nutrients needed to replenish your energy. The rest of the day will be spent relaxing at the basecamp, allowing your body to recover and adapt to the altitude before the upcoming climbs.

Your day begins with a pick-up at midday, around 12:00 PM, followed by lunch and a meeting with your guides. Afterward, you will be transferred from your current location to the Chimborazo car park at 4,800 meters. From here, we continue to the High Camp, located at 5,200 meters (17,060 feet). This will be your base for the evening and the starting point for your climb. Once at High Camp, you'll have time to settle in, organize your gear, and get ready for the climb ahead.
Dinner will be served at 5:00 PM, providing a nourishing and energizing meal to fuel you for the challenging ascent. After dinner, you'll have time to relax, check your equipment, and rest before the big climb. The climb will begin at 10:00 PM, with your guide leading the way toward the summit of Chimborazo. Starting the climb at night allows for optimal conditions on the glacier and ensures you'll reach the summit by sunrise. As you make your way up, you'll experience the thrill of moving through the Andean night, with stunning views of the starry sky and Chimborazo’s rugged beauty illuminated by moonlight.

The climb starts at 00:00PM, heading up the glacier under the clear night sky. Using headlamps to light the way, you'll follow your guide along the icy trail, step by step. The climb is steady and challenging, requiring focus and effort as you move higher through the thin mountain air. Along the way, you’ll take short breaks to catch your breath and stay hydrated.
After several hours of climbing, you’ll reach Chimborazo’s summit between 6:00 and 7:30 AM. Standing at the top, you’ll see an unforgettable view of the surrounding valleys, nearby peaks, and the sunrise lighting up the landscape. It’s a moment of achievement and awe, knowing you’ve reached the highest point in Ecuador and one of the most remarkable peaks in the world.
After enjoying the view, you’ll start heading back down the glacier. The descent is faster but still requires care as you make your way to the refuge. Once you arrive at the basecamp lodge, a warm breakfast will be ready for you, giving you time to relax and recover. Afterward, you’ll be transferred back to Riobamba, bringing your Chimborazo adventure to an end.
